Crocheted Wreaths for the Home
In this warmly photographed guide, Anna Nikipirowicz shares 12 year-round wreath designs that bring nature-inspired charm into any space. The patterns range from bright spring blooms to cozy winter textures, with accompanying mini projects that adapt each main wreath into garlands, terrariums, or decorative accents. Clear, step-by-step instructions and vibrant photography guide you through construction, from choosing yarn weights to finishing touches that elevate results from homemade to handmade-looking professional. Aimed at confident beginners through intermediate crocheters, this book encourages you to personalize palettes and textures, turning walls and doors into evolving canvases of craft.
Tunisian Crochet Stitch Dictionary
This compact reference gathers 150 of the most used Tunisian crochet stitches, spanning foundational stitches to elaborate cables and lace. It emphasizes practical technique with actual-size swatches, charts, and photo instructions that help you verify stitches as you learn. Anna Nikipirowicz draws on her teaching experience to present approachable guidance suitable for beginners while still offering depth for more experienced makers seeking new textures and structures. The dictionary format makes it a go-to tool for expanding your repertoire, enabling you to craft dense fabrics that marry durability with elegance in a wide range of projects.
Twenty to Crochet: Crocheted Flowers to Wear
This collection translates floral crochet into stylish, portable accessories. The 20 patterns focus on wearable flowers—delicate petals and blossoms that can serve as brooches, accents on hats or scarves, or decorative touches for bags. Designed for clarity and ease of reproduction, the patterns rely on clean construction with intuitive diagrams. Whether you’re upgrading everyday outfits or crafting thoughtful gifts, these wearable florals offer quick, satisfying results that showcase the charm of crochet in fashion-forward, approachable forms.

About the Author:
Anna Nikipirowicz is a respected crochet and knit designer, tutor, and author. Her patterns have appeared in Inside Crochet and other craft magazines, and she is a familiar presence on Yarn Lane TV, where she shares techniques and projects with a wide audience. Her books balance accessible instruction with opportunities for advanced experimentation, reflecting a consistent commitment to helping readers build confidence while enjoying the process of making.
